It was decided in a meeting of the Organizing Committee for the Second National Workshop on Instrument Maintenance and Repair that the Organizing Committee would act as an ad hoc Executive Committee (EC) of NITUB until formal EC is formed. The ad hoc executive Committee was as follows:

The ad hoc Executive Committee of NITUB framed a constitution of NITUB which was adopted in a general meeting of the members of NITUB in the year 2001. Since then the Executive Committee of NITUB is elected every three years as per constitution of NITUB.

NITUB has four salaried staff members who are maintaining the office of NITUB Mr. Md. Abul Kalam Chowdhury and Md. Tanvir Uddin, Instrument Engineers is full time employee of NITUB. NITUB has also two part time employess of which one is office assistant and the other one is cleaner.
Academicians, research scientists and professionals engaged in scientific education research and related activities are eligible to apply for membership of NITUB in a prescribed form (enclosed). Qualified instrument technical personnel may also apply for membership with the recommendation of two members of NITUB. The membership application for NITUB is considered in a meeting of the Executive Committee (EC) of NITUB to get approval. The life membership fee is Tk. 2000/- (two thousand).

At present, NITUB has a total of 292 members, including 11 founding members and 281 life members (among whom 6 are foreign members). Young university faculty, college teachers, graduate students, scientists, and technical personnel actively participate in NITUB activities.
